Preferencja przerwy

W niektórych miejscach kierowcy nie mają możliwości bezpiecznego zatrzymania się (np. na terenach podwyższonych, promach, w podziemiach i na innych obszarach o ograniczonym dostępie). Funkcja Stopover przenosi punkt pośredni do pobliskiego miejsca, jeśli lokalizacja nie jest odpowiednia do postoju pojazdu. Gdy ustawisz setVehicleStopover na true, punkt pośredni zostanie automatycznie przeniesiony podczas obliczania trasy, jeśli dostępna jest alternatywna lokalizacja.

Jak to działa

Ustawienie przystanków ustawia się podczas tworzenia punktu pośredniego dla tego przystanku. W tym celu określ preferencję setVehicleStopover, jak w tym przykładzie:

Waypoint waypoint =
   Waypoint.builder()
           .setLatLng(latitude, longitude)
           .setTitle("Somewhere in Sydney")
           .setVehicleStopover(true)
           .build()